11 mm Metric Ratcheting Combination Wrench

The Husky 11 mm 12-Point Metric Ratcheting Combination Wrench delivers professional-grade performance with its 72-tooth ratcheting box end and durable Chrome Alloy steel construction. Its mirror chrome finish resists rust, while the 0° offset head and large size markings ensure ease of use and quick identification. Perfect for tackling tough jobs with precision and efficiency.


Key Features:

  • Ratcheting Box End: 72-tooth, 12-point ratcheting mechanism requires only 5° to engage fasteners for efficient tightening and loosening.
  • Durable Construction: Made from heat-treated Chrome Alloy steel for superior strength and long-lasting wear protection.
  • Corrosion Resistance: Mirror chrome finish resists rust and easily wipes clean of oil and dirt.
  • Precision Design: 0° offset head and chamfered lead-ins provide maximum clearance and quick, easy placement onto fasteners.
  • Easy Identification: Large, hard-stamped size markings ensure quick and accurate tool selection.

Frequently Asked Questions (FAQ):

Q: Is this wrench suitable for professional use?
A: Yes, the Husky 11 mm Ratcheting Combination Wrench is constructed from heat-treated Chrome Alloy steel and meets or exceeds ANSI standards, making it ideal for both professional and DIY applications.


Q: How does the ratcheting mechanism work?
A: The 72-tooth, 12-point ratcheting box end requires only 5° of movement to engage fasteners, allowing for efficient tightening and loosening in tight spaces.


Q: Is the wrench resistant to rust and corrosion?
A: Yes, the mirror chrome finish provides excellent resistance to rust and corrosion, ensuring long-lasting durability.


Q: What is the warranty on this product?
A: This wrench is backed by a lifetime warranty with no questions asked and no receipt required.


Q: Can this wrench be used on both metric and standard fasteners?
A: This specific wrench is designed for 11 mm metric fasteners and is not intended for use with standard (imperial) sizes.
